Analysis of liquid dripping at peristaltic pump outlet

2022-01-10
Peristaltic Pump export produces dripping phenomenon: when we were in use, when the peristaltic pump stop, often like the liquid in the pipeline as the pump stop also immediately downstream, but with pseudo, we often find that liquid pipeline will drop down slowly, until dripping droop of the liquid in the pipe after the stop flow. This is a big problem when we use peristaltic pumps as quantitative tools. How does this drip happen? Peristaltic pump engineer will tell you, this is a normal phenomenon of liquid flow, the main reason is that the liquid at work is full of sag in the export pipeline, but when the pump stops, export pipeline in the liquid because of its gravity and ductility, will follow the export natural drip edge, until all the liquid drip off the drooping line will stop.
In addition to the liquid weight dripping, peristaltic pump will produce a siphonage phenomenon? The answer is no. Because of the working reasons of the peristaltic pump, the runner needs to completely press the pump tube during the working process of the peristaltic pump, so that the inlet end can produce negative pressure and the outlet end can produce positive pressure. Therefore, when the peristaltic pump stops running, the inlet and outlet are completely shut off. Therefore, although the outlet pipeline is sagging, the whole Peristaltic Pump Hose will not produce a siphon phenomenon.
We know the reason for the liquid dripping in the peristaltic pump outlet pipeline, how to solve it?
Peristaltic pump answers and analysis is as follows: the fluid in the pipeline because of its gravity will fall, but the liquid due to full of line, since only one end of the line and the atmosphere are interlinked, the other end of the peristaltic pump wheel crushed with the atmosphere, the liquid in the pipe can produce tension, but because of the tension is unable to overcome the gravity of the liquid, so the liquid will drip. Even though we know that the liquid tension in the pipeline is too small, is there a way to expand the tension, can overcome the gravity? Yes, of course, we can easily increase the tension of the liquid in the pipeline by reducing the diameter of the outlet of the pipeline, to solve the phenomenon of liquid dripping. Of course, in addition to this simple method, we can also increase the one-way pressure valve at the outlet to solve the dripping phenomenon. When the pump works, the pressure generated by the pump itself will open the one-way valve, and when the pump stops, the pressure will disappear and the one-way valve will automatically close.
Problems need attention in the practical work: as the peristaltic pump pulse phenomena exist in the process of running, i.e. peristaltic pump fluid delivery time will be reduced in the liquid flow in the pipe due to pulse suddenly formed the smoke and back to the suction phenomenon, so we set the export of small-diameter pipeline length must be more than the length of the peristaltic pump to suck. Because the small diameter is set too small, the liquid outlet liquid level in the pipeline does not stay in the small-diameter pipeline because of pumping back, the larger tension of the liquid is not formed, and it will not play the role of dripping prevention naturally.

Liquid tension anti-drip also has its limitations, because the liquid itself will be vaporized over time, so if you need liquid anti-drip for a long time, then it may be ineffective with evaporation, so if your system will often be used for a while to a long time after shutdown, Then complete the fully closed check valve system is the best solution.
